Exploring the Invisible: FLIR Thermal Imaging
The world we perceive is limited by our eyes, which can only detect a narrow band of electromagnetic radiation known as visible light. However, beyond this visible spectrum lies a wealth of information hidden in infrared (IR) radiation, which emits heat energy. Thermal imaging systems leverage this power, revealing temperature variations invisible to the human eye. This remarkable technology has revolutionized numerous fields, from industrial inspection to medical diagnosis. By detecting these minute heat differences, FLIR cameras offer a unique perspective on our surroundings, enabling users to identify hotspots, monitor performance, and improve efficiency in ways never before possible.
